Another testimony to the Bengali passion for fish- this dish is seldom to be found outside Bengal.
Ingredients:
1 lb. fish fillet, cut into pieces
1 tbsp. garlic paste
1 tsp. onion powder
1 tsp. lemon juice
Salt and pepper to taste
Bread crumbs and an egg - optional
Cilantro/coriander leaves
4 tsp. oil
How to cook:
Mix the fish, lemon juice, salt and pepper, cilantro/coriander leaves and onion powder and keep aside for a few hours. Heat oil in a non-stick frying pan and fry the fish on medium high heat for ten minutes on either side. Optionally, dip the fish in beaten egg, coat with bread crumbs and fry.
